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								656f573c0a
								
							
								
							
						 | 
						
							
							
								
								Removed from wrap the use of "using namespace xxx" statements - wasn't fully supported before, and now we have real namespace support
							
							
							
							
							
						 | 
						
							2012-07-23 18:24:43 +00:00 | 
						
					
				
					
						
							
							
								 
								Richard Roberts
							
						 | 
						
							
							
							
							
								
							
								8dbffd4629
								
							
								
							
						 | 
						
							
							
								
								Wrap generates Matlab namespaces, so now 'import gtsam.*' allows class names like Values, NonlinearFactor, to be used.  Without import, syntax is gtsam.Values, etc.
							
							
							
							
							
						 | 
						
							2012-07-18 15:47:06 +00:00 | 
						
					
				
					
						
							
							
								 
								Richard Roberts
							
						 | 
						
							
							
							
							
								
							
								ce12f3d255
								
							
								
							
						 | 
						
							
							
								
								Code cleanup and comments
							
							
							
							
							
						 | 
						
							2012-07-12 22:28:28 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								5d58dbd512
								
							
								
							
						 | 
						
							
							
								
								Fixed testWrap so that it passes, fixed dependency checking in codegen, fixed warnings
							
							
							
							
							
						 | 
						
							2012-07-10 14:21:58 +00:00 | 
						
					
				
					
						
							
							
								 
								Richard Roberts
							
						 | 
						
							
							
							
							
								
							
								e915e666b5
								
							
								
							
						 | 
						
							
							
								
								Can return abstract base classes from functions in matlab wrapper, i.e. Values::at
							
							
							
							
							
						 | 
						
							2012-07-09 20:19:37 +00:00 | 
						
					
				
					
						
							
							
								 
								Richard Roberts
							
						 | 
						
							
							
							
							
								
							
								f774a380ec
								
							
								
							
						 | 
						
							
							
								
								Implemented method overloading in matlab wrapper, made static functions static in matlab classes
							
							
							
							
							
						 | 
						
							2012-07-05 14:05:00 +00:00 | 
						
					
				
					
						
							
							
								 
								Richard Roberts
							
						 | 
						
							
							
							
							
								
							
								b5937ce35d
								
							
								
							
						 | 
						
							
							
								
								Modified wrap to generate a single cpp wrapper file containing all wrapped functions, and one .m file per class and static method.
							
							
							
							
							
						 | 
						
							2012-07-05 14:04:36 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								6a0da1519a
								
							
								
							
						 | 
						
							
							
								
								Cleanup in wrap
							
							
							
							
							
						 | 
						
							2011-12-11 21:09:07 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								06dbc2b650
								
							
								
							
						 | 
						
							
							
								
								Changed namespace mechanism in wrap to "using namespace gtsam;" inside gtsam.h
							
							
							
							
							
						 | 
						
							2011-12-09 20:29:47 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								9dff4c35bd
								
							
								
							
						 | 
						
							
							
								
								Added include overrides to parser
							
							
							
							
							
						 | 
						
							2011-12-09 15:44:35 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								48a2056020
								
							
								
							
						 | 
						
							
							
								
								Added codegen for namespace handling, examples exercising namespaces
							
							
							
							
							
						 | 
						
							2011-12-08 20:51:13 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								92a0cf67c9
								
							
								
							
						 | 
						
							
							
								
								Fixed ambiguity issues with returning non-ptr classes, added new copies of functions to gtsam.h and depreciated old ones
							
							
							
							
							
						 | 
						
							2011-12-07 03:05:37 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								3050dc2dde
								
							
								
							
						 | 
						
							
							
								
								Added wrap components to "wrap" namespace, added options for installing wrap program
							
							
							
							
							
						 | 
						
							2011-12-02 16:43:15 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								221a6ad877
								
							
								
							
						 | 
						
							
							
								
								Added static function parsing to wrap, included Expmap/Logmap in geometric objects.  Static functions appear to still crash matlab, however.
							
							
							
							
							
						 | 
						
							2011-12-02 02:32:18 +00:00 | 
						
					
				
					
						
							
							
								 
								Frank Dellaert
							
						 | 
						
							
							
							
							
								
							
								307fd2737a
								
							
								
							
						 | 
						
							
							
								
								Fixed instance variable naming convention
							
							
							
							
							
						 | 
						
							2011-10-21 02:35:11 +00:00 | 
						
					
				
					
						
							
							
								 
								Frank Dellaert
							
						 | 
						
							
							
							
							
								
							
								5fd71a33eb
								
							
								
							
						 | 
						
							
							
								
								Documentation
							
							
							
							
							
						 | 
						
							2011-10-14 04:43:06 +00:00 | 
						
					
				
					
						
							
							
								 
								Frank Dellaert
							
						 | 
						
							
							
							
							
								
							
								56d1d6ae34
								
							
								
							
						 | 
						
							
							
								
								Fixed some Doxygen problems with global replace
							
							
							
							
							
						 | 
						
							2011-10-14 03:23:14 +00:00 | 
						
					
				
					
						
							
							
								 
								Alex Cunningham
							
						 | 
						
							
							
							
							
								
							
								f4d9ca72a8
								
							
								
							
						 | 
						
							
							
								
								Added back the matlab interface to gtsam
							
							
							
							
							
						 | 
						
							2011-10-13 18:41:56 +00:00 | 
						
					
				
					
						
							
							
								 
								Richard Roberts
							
						 | 
						
							
							
							
							
								
							
								08beb34060
								
							
								
							
						 | 
						
							
							
								
								Moved doc and wrap to experimental
							
							
							
							
							
						 | 
						
							2010-10-25 21:16:20 +00:00 | 
						
					
				
					
						
							
							
								 
								Kai Ni
							
						 | 
						
							
							
							
							
								
							
								24d499039f
								
							
								
							
						 | 
						
							
							
								
								prepend license information on all the codes
							
							
							
							
							
						 | 
						
							2010-10-14 04:54:38 +00:00 | 
						
					
				
					
						
							
							
								 
								Richard Roberts
							
						 | 
						
							
							
							
							
								
							
								1df4385d84
								
							
								
							
						 | 
						
							
							
								
								Added 'verbose' flag, making unit tests silent
							
							
							
							
							
						 | 
						
							2010-02-23 17:04:49 +00:00 | 
						
					
				
					
						
							
							
								 
								Richard Roberts
							
						 | 
						
							
							
							
							
								
							
								d80fa24a9f
								
							
								
							
						 | 
						
							
							
								
								Fixing directory structure
							
							
							
							
							
						 | 
						
							2009-08-21 22:23:24 +00:00 |